From 96cfc7e96ff72256dd2fbedf08c2c051d9d003fc Mon Sep 17 00:00:00 2001 From: Alexander Schlemmer <alexander.schlemmer@ds.mpg.de> Date: Thu, 5 Dec 2019 15:35:57 +0100 Subject: [PATCH] DOC: docstring added for leap seconds initialization procedure --- src/main/java/caosdb/datetime/UTCDateTime.java | 5 +++++ 1 file changed, 5 insertions(+) diff --git a/src/main/java/caosdb/datetime/UTCDateTime.java b/src/main/java/caosdb/datetime/UTCDateTime.java index 846c8f9f..57176cce 100644 --- a/src/main/java/caosdb/datetime/UTCDateTime.java +++ b/src/main/java/caosdb/datetime/UTCDateTime.java @@ -162,6 +162,11 @@ public class UTCDateTime implements Interval { addLeapSecond(gc.getTimeInMillis() / 1000); } + /** + * Initialize the container with known leap seconds. This container has to be updated according to future changes of leap seconds. + * + * Currently all leap seconds between 1972 and 2019 are registered here, with the most recent leap second being added for December 2016. + */ private static void initLeapSeconds() { // june 1972 -- GitLab